1087188 | FRANCE. Philip VI le Fortune. (King, 1328-1350).
(1328-50) AV Ecú d'Or. PCGS MS62. 4.49gm. + PhILIPPVS : DЄI x | x GRA x | FRAnCORVM : RЄX. King seated on Gothic throne, a sword in his right hand and his left supporting a shield
/ + o XP'C : VInCIT : XP'C : RЄGИAT : XP'C : INPЄRAT. Cross fleurée with voided quatrefoil in center and at the ends of the limbs, leaves in angles; all within a quadrilobe with trefoils in spandrels. Duplessy 249E; Ciani 282; Laf. 262; Fr.-270.
